1The ''Dark Titans'' duology is a ''WesternAnimation/TeenTitans2003''/''Manga/RanmaOneHalf'' crossover by Lathis. The series consists of two fics: ''[[http://www.fanfiction.net/s/2957130/1/The_Titans_and_the_Lost_Boy The Titans and the Lost Boy]]'', written from 2006-2007, and ''[[http://www.fanfiction.net/s/3462706/1/Dark_Titans Dark Titans]]'', started in 2007. It was on hiatus between 2012 and 2020 before resuming and is currently ongoing. The premise is very simple: take Jump City, insert the Nerima Wrecking Crew. Set to liquefy, serve chilled. In execution, on the other hand, it's actually a complex work.

3''The Titans and the Lost Boy'' begins with H.I.V.E. taking an interest in the legends of Jusenkyo and the Titans following them out to the Bayankala Mountain Range. By sheer coincidence, the Titans cross paths with Ryouga, who demonstrates his abilities by blowing up Cinderblock and helping the team take care of H.I.V.E. After a stopover in the Amazon village to repair the T-ship, the Titans return home and Ryouga goes back to his wandering...

5...only to run headlong into Brother Blood.

7From there the story kicks into high gear when Blood brainwashes Ryouga and uses his knowledge to target members of the Nerima Wrecking Crew for further "recruitment", drawing the main cast of Ranma 1/2 into the action as they either unwillingly join H.I.V.E. Academy or scramble desperately to find their kidnapped friends and rivals. Meanwhile the Titans are faced with the unenviable position of being the only thing standing between Jump City and an army of brainwashed martial artists.

9The story continues in ''Dark Titans'', which changes things up a bit; instead of focusing on a single chain of events, the story is split up into distinct arcs, with each arc focusing on a different group of characters following the aftermath of ''TALB'''s grand finale with bits of the others thrown in occasionally for variety.

11* '''Red XX?:''' Focuses on the Titans and their newest members dealing with the theft of the Red X suit. Also lays the groundwork for the other arcs via occasional focus on other groups.
12* '''Big Trouble In Little Tokyo:''' The sudden appearance of Brushogun forces Ranma to assemble his own Super Hero team to deal with an enemy he can't possibly handle on his own. This is the most famous and downright brilliant part of the story, with some LeaningOnTheFourthWall for extra flavour.
13* '''This Ain't A Scene:''' Cologne matches wits with Lex Luthor, but Jinx and Happosai are in town as well...
14* '''Titan Rising:''' Ryouga discovers a way to resurrect Terra, but her control issues are worse than ever and she's going to need a mentor. Meanwhile, Jinx and Happosai continue their training trip across DC America, setting their sights on Gotham City as the ideal place to test Jinx's skills.
15* '''Wedding Party:''' The Titans attempt to prevent Starfire from being married off while Blackfire makes a bid for the throne, Ryouga and Terra go camping, and Speedy learns the consequences of disrespecting others.

17After ''FanFic/DarkTitans'' comes ''FanFic/ReflectionsLostOnADarkRoad'', a [[MegaCrossover crossover fic]] written by [[FanFic/DarkTitans Lathis]] and [[FanFic/TheRoadToCydonia Cap'n Chryssalid]]. It is also an extremely well-written fanfic, but is initially far darker and more disturbing than what came before.
